    I was in Austin for the day and found this recommendation from TikTok! They close at 2PM and they were able to get me in right before they closed so I'm forever grateful lol I wanted to try some pastries but they let me know that they are made fresh, in-house everyday and they go fast! So they were sold out. I ended up ordering the Texas hash and the cinnamon rose which was like a French toast with the most immaculate choice of toppings on it. I'm a sweet and savory girl and they both were phenomenal. The hash was made with a mole sauce that gave it this Mexican taste to or which I absolutely loved. The cinnamon toast also had a really good mascarpone and this caramelized crunch that I enjoyed a lot. You also got a really good bang for your buck so I'll definitely be back the next time I'm in Austin!

    First time at Paperboy South and it did not disappoint. This location takes reservations (highly recommend making one to avoid long waits) and offers validated parking for the first hour in the adjacent garage, which is convenient. The restaurant offers indoor and outdoor seating spaces, both of which are cozy and comfortable. I started with a hot vanilla latte, which was delicious. For food, my girlfriend and I ordered: 1. chorizo and potato empanada to share - this was pretty oily. I've had better empanadas. This was a miss for me. 2. Paperboy pancake wjth blueberries, and a side of eggs + bacon. The bacon was crispy just the way I like it. Eggs were cooked to order and the pancake was decadent, massive, and delicious. This meal fed two of us easily. They brought some rice krispy treats out for dessert along with the check, which was a nice sweet bite to round out a good meal. Worth a visit.

    Solid food and service. We were out on the patio in the late morning and the heaters did their work, very comfortable. It took about 25 minutes for us to get our food but once we addressed it their team was on top of it. We started with the cheddar jalapeño biscuits and they weren't as bold in their flavor as I would have preferred, but we enjoyed them. Chicken and biscuits were on point and the gravy is very good. The highlight for me was the cheese grits, as good as I've had...Really dug the grits! My wife had the pancakes and bacon. She thought the pancakes leaned a little too much towards cornbread (she's a pancake traditionalist). The bacon was fine, nothing to write home about. To be honest, I always use Phoebe's bacon as the standard, which may not be fair, but once you know what a fantastic piece of bacon tastes like you never forget it. We enjoyed Paperboy, it's probably a bit overhyped which is not their fault but it's definitely a solid choice for breakfast in ATX.

    I've been wanting to try this place for years and finally had the chance to dine there the other day. While the service was absolutely incredible, I didn't find the food itself to be anything special. I ordered the Texas Hash. The pork and sweet potatoes were good, but nothing unique about them. My parents had ordered the Chicken & Biscuit and the Kale Salad. The Chicken & Biscuit was definitely the best order. The chicken was perfectly crisp and well-seasoned. I highly recommend. As for the Kale Salad, both my mom and I found it to be too salty. I did enjoy the coffee here. Their earl gray syrup was the perfect addition to my cortado! Back to the service, I thought the people here were so incredibly friendly. We brought our dog, and they provided her with a water bowl--so thoughtful! The ambiance was nice as well. We sat outside, and they had heaters on throughout the patio, which we appreciated.
